New Torrid Collection: Military Chic

 

Military Chic is another collection recently premiered at Torrid. The style is more nautical rather than focusing on the traditional camouflage and army inspirations. Honestly there wasn't one piece that literally made me go "wow". However, I do like that they are all very versatile and comfortable for every day wear. I especially love the stripes which mix beautifully with the soft color palette. (Who said curvy girls shouldn't wear horizontal stripes) Overall this collection offers classic yet trendy pieces to be worn throughout any season.

Paco Peregrín was born in Almeria, Spain.

º He is a Bachelor of Fine Arts at Seville University and extends his formation in image and new means of expression in recognized centres of prestige such as International Center Of Photography (NYC), Central Saint Martins College of Art and Design (London), Andalusian Centre of Contemporary Art, Fundació Pilar i Joan Miró a Mallorca, The Andalusian Centre of Photography, Complutense University of Madrid, University of Santiago de Compostela, EFTI, etc. which were directed by personalities of international stature.

º Paco has also photographed and art-directed high-profile campaigns for global household names like Nike, Diesel, Adidas, Lee, Vögele Shoes, Gant, Mazda, Toyota, Levi's, EMI Music, Cosmopolitan TV, Jacinto Usán, Maria Barros, Cosentino, Paramita, Carlsberg, etc.

º He publishes for recognized magazines as Vanity Fair (Italy), Glamour (Spain), ELLE (México), Zink (USA), Rolling Stone (Spain), Neo2 (Spain), Eyemazing (the Netherlands), Vision (China), Edelweiss (Switzerland), Vanidad (Spain), Hint (USA), FHM (Spain), Flux (UK), DT (Spain), Inspire (Slovakia) or Tendencias (Spain).

º He receives numerous recognitions. He has won a Gold Lux 2008 award (first place in the National Professional Photography Awards in Spain) in the 'Fashion and Beauty' category. His work is part of important artistic collections in the world of the image.

º Paco Peregrín’s style has earned him credibility as one of the most exciting photographers working in advertising,  beauty,  art and fashion today. His unmistakable signature belies his background in design, communication, theatre and painting. Paco’s photography carries a perfect blend of sensuality with avant garde. Paco’s juxtapositions shows a mastery of the fine line between commercial success and art. Fusing hyper-real futurism with high-end beauty images, he is one of the talents of the Spanish photography with major personality. His work is defined by a marked character of hybridization of styles where come together the latest fashion trends and the most personal conceptual reflections, always providing to his images with a sensual, elegant and mysterious, even perturbing character, trying to interrelate the point of view of the traditional spectator of works of art with the most generic public of the mass-media.

º He resides in Madrid but he works worldwide and his work has been exhibited in many countries.
